×

Information processor, processing method and program for displaying a virtual image

  • US 8,751,969 B2
  • Filed: 06/30/2010
  • Issued: 06/10/2014
  • Est. Priority Date: 07/21/2009
  • Status: Active Grant
First Claim
Patent Images

1. An information processor comprising:

  • a coordinate processing module adapted to determine whether a position of a cursor displayed on a first display section, is located in or outside an area of the first display section and output cursor position information to a virtual object management section if the cursor is located outside the area of the first display section;

    a camera adapted to capture an image made up of a real object including the first display section;

    a three-dimensional information analysis section adapted to analyze a three-dimensional position of the real object included in the camera-captured image;

    a second display section adapted to display the camera-captured image;

    a virtual object management section adapted to generate a virtual object different from the real object included in the camera-captured image and generate a composite image including the generated virtual object and the real object so as to display the composite image on the second display section; and

    an application execution section adapted to process a specified object specified by the cursor,wherein the virtual object management section calculates a three-dimensional position of the cursor based on the cursor position information supplied from the coordinate processing module so as to display, on the second display section, the composite image in which a virtual cursor is placed at a first calculated position;

    wherein the application execution section determines whether the specified object is moved by the cursor to locate in or outside the area of the first display section and outputs object position information of the specified object to the virtual object management section if the specified object is moved to locate outside the area of the first display section; and

    wherein the virtual object management section calculates a three-dimensional position of the specified object based on the object position information of the specified object so as to display, on the second display section, a composite image in which a virtual specified object is placed at a second calculated position.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×